10:57 : Investigations are carried out by investigators from the Central Office for Combating Crimes Against Humanity and Hate Crimes (OCLCH). A unit dedicated to Ukraine conducts investigative work “pretty classic”, according to General Jean-Philippe Reiland, who heads this office attached to the gendarmerie. With one exception, and not the least: “The crime scene escapes us: it is not on national territory and it is difficult to access it.” Going there is therefore essential to understand what could have happened. Three members of the Pnat and seven gendarmes were able to carry out a mission in Ukraine last September.

10:57 : “Justice takes the time to gather evidence so that it can be established. It’s very long, but I understand it.”

An investigation was opened by French justice after the death of journalist Frédéric Leclerc-Imhoff, killed by shrapnel, on May 30, 2022, in the Luhansk region. The investigations continue little by little, so his mother, Sylvie Imhoff, takes his trouble patiently.

10:56 : Since the start of the Russian offensive in Ukraine, seven investigations have been opened in France for “war crimes” by the National Anti-Terrorist Prosecutor’s Office (Pnat), within which there is a dedicated unit. I will explain to you the painstaking work of the French magistrates and gendarmes, who have to deal with the geographical distance from the crime scene and the limited means.

11:46 : China called on Russia and Ukraine to hold peace talks and rejected any use of nuclear weapons. “All parties should support Russia and Ukraine to work in the same direction, and resume direct dialogue as soon as possible” in view of a “peaceful solution”estimated the Chinese Ministry of Foreign Affairs.

11:35 a.m. : A year after the invasion of Ukraine, Volodymyr Zelensky set the goal of defeating Russia “This year”. “Whether [nos] partners keep their word and meet deadlines, an inevitable victory awaits us”said the Ukrainian president yesterday at a press conference.
